Collector Nagrani Reviews 100-Day Plan Classes

Bhimavaram, Feb 03: District Collector Chadala Nagrani paid a surprise visit on Tuesday to the Zilla Parishad High School at Pedakapavaram in Akividu mandal, where special classes are being conducted for Class 10 students as part of the “100-Day Plan.”
The Collector reviewed student attendance and the marks obtained in daily mock tests, interacting personally with students to understand their progress. She advised them to attend school regularly and study sincerely. She emphasized that subjects studied from Class 6 to Class 10 form the foundation for competitive exams such as Group-1, Group-2, UPSC, and IAS. She encouraged students to set goals, study well, and build stable careers to support their parents in the future.
She suggested that after passing Class 10, students may consider courses like ITI, Polytechnic, and Nursing, which offer good employment opportunities upon completion. She also advised students to attempt the Police Constable exam and asked teachers to guide students about various course options and their benefits after Class 10. Students were encouraged to make good use of the school library and cultivate the habit of reading to gain social and economic awareness. The Collector took a pledge from students to study well and care for their parents.
She then inspected the school’s sports equipment, computer lab, library, laboratory, Miyawaki forest, basketball court, and shuttle court, and gave suggestions to the headmaster.Later, the Collector inspected the Solid Waste Management center in the village and enquired about the processing methods. She instructed the Sarpanch and MPP to create awareness among villagers to segregate wet and dry waste, stating that failure to do so harms society.
She also inspected the Rural Protected Water Supply Scheme, filter beds, the village pond, and water pumping systems, issuing directions to RWS officials to ensure the supply of safe drinking water. She ordered that leakages be prevented to avoid contamination and that proper chlorination be maintained.
The Collector personally reviewed water tax collection records, interacted with a taxpayer, and directed the Village Secretary and VRVO to ensure timely collection and remittance to the government account without any pending dues.
DEO E. Narayana, Swarna Gram/Ward Officer Y. Dosi Reddy, RWS SE Srinivasa Rao, Sarpanch Baby Snethu, MPP Katari Jayalakshmi, MEO Ravindranath, Headmaster A.L.V. Satyanarayana, Tahsildar Farooq, In-charge MPDO B.E. Markandeswara Rao, Panchayat Secretary Venkanna, VRVO Subbarao, and others participated in the program.
